Much of the action takes place in the family apartment the place where randy was arrested by the police in contrast, the apartment where tito and his grandmother live is a safe heaven, a place of warmth, love, and good food. Pseudoscorpions are generally beneficial to humans since they prey on clothes moth larvae, carpet beetle larvae, booklice, ants, mites, and small flies.
